Interpretation
The song lyrics "I Think I Am Starting to Lose It" by
Frank Black deal with a person who feels like they are losing their mind. The lines of the lyrics express that everyone has something to say and acts with a strong presence like a skilled operator. However, the person feels alone and decides to continue on their own.
The lyrics also mention that there is a kind of heaven in the mind. This can be interpreted as a metaphor for positive thoughts or dreams. But at the same time, chaos, pain, and confusion are also present. The person feels that chaos is sitting in their seat and that they are starting to be hurt by pathetic feelings. It is also mentioned that the myth (or imagination) mixes things up.
The repeated phrase "I think I'm starting to lose it" expresses the growing insecurity and state of confusion of the person. It seems like they are losing control of their thoughts and feelings.
Overall, the song lyrics reflect the emotional roller coaster of a person who is in a state of uncertainty and confusion. It is about grappling with internal conflicts and seeking clarity and stability in one's own mind.
